### Haulgrid fuel report — release steps

Each release of the Haulgrid fleet fuel-usage report generator must be built from a clean checkout. Verify the sample fleet dataset produces totals matching last quarter's baseline within 0.5%. Tag, build, and sign the package; the ops gateway refuses unsigned uploads without exception. Complete the signing step with the key shown below.

deploy key for hawef-yadup: bky19_kVT4YunTZZSTyhFQQoK

### Step 2: Swap the Solver Backend

Quick heads-up for the sync: we're moving the Bellwick timetable solver off the old greedy allocator and onto the constraint engine. Room-clash penalties are now hard constraints, so the handful of schools that relied on "soft double-booking" will see failures — that's intentional, flag them to support. Run the dry-run mode against last term's data first. The engine starts with these settings.

settings of tawig-hawef:
[zorath]
port = 7000
region = north-1
host = zorath.tolvaqworks.corp
timeout_ms = 1000
retries = 1

Sales leads, please note the following ahead of the review. Our fleet policy with Harrowgate Mutual renews next quarter. The proposed premium rises 11%, reflecting two claims in the Dunmore region and an expanded vehicle count. We have negotiated a higher deductible to soften the increase and added coverage for leased demo units. No changes to driver eligibility rules. Budget holders should factor the revised premium into territory cost plans. The confidential note below explains why this renewal matters strategically.

board note of kageg-bahof: The renewal with Holwynax Holdings closes at $2 million a year, 5 percent below the last contract. Project Ulaath slips by two quarters because of the supplier delay.